Devices including Primus Rehabilitation by BTE Technologies with patient monitors such as spirometers, electrocardiographs, stress monitors, electromyography (EMG) are crucial in maintaining top form for an athlete and are also useful in studying the performance of competitors. High-end technologies such as balance and gait monitors, and motion analysis are used in experiments to determine the optimum positioning of the body with respect to the type of sport played.

Each type of sport puts a certain amount of pressure on particular areas of the body. Baseball pitchers and cricket bowlers tend to injure their shoulders more often.

Similarly, batsmen tend to injure their arms and wrists at a higher rate. Marathon runners, basketball players, and tennis players have a high rate of muscle injuries in the limbs.
